A 19th century American table centrepiece stand, the column cast in the form of a Chinese peasant leaning against a tree, on a circular plinth base with square tapered supports, engraved 'Fakei Cup', 30cm. high, stamped 'Tiffany & Co', 'English Sterling 925-1000', '550 Broadway', with the initial 'M' for J C Moore, 1424gm., 45.79oz *The Fakei Cup horse race was first run in Hong Kong in 1856.

A good early 19th century Chinese Export lacquer pedestal work table, the rectangular hinged top finely decorated in raised gilt with figures and pagodas within dragon inhabited borders, the conforming interior with fitted lift-out tray revealing further chinoiserie decorated lidded compartments, the internal lid surface richly adorned with an Oriental garden party, the front and sides with further views, on conforming baluster turned upright and triform platform base with lion paw feet, minor wear and repairs only, 78cm high, 63cm wide, 41cm deep.
A George III mahogany architect's table, the concertina action rising two-part moulded edge top with unusual ratchet locking mechanism over pull-forward frieze and dividing front legs enclosing baize lined slide and incomplete compartments, with pivoted inkwell drawer to side and foliate cast brass handles to front, on four substantial caddy moulded square section supports with pierced angle brackets, 90cm high (top folded), 101cm wide, 63cm deep.
